Barcelona, Sep 17 (AP) Barcelona’s Lamine Yamal has been ruled out of their Champions League opener against Newcastle on Thursday due to an injury. The Catalan club confirmed on Wednesday that Yamal has not been included in the squad traveling to England for the league phase of the Champions League. This follows his absence from the Spanish league match against Valencia on Sunday. The star forward is experiencing discomfort in his pubic area, a condition that arose after his stint with Spain's national team during the international break. Barcelona coach Hansi Flick expressed his displeasure with Spain for fielding Yamal for unnecessary durations during decisive victories in two World Cup qualifiers. Flick criticized Spain’s decision, claiming they were aware of Yamal's discomfort yet chose to play him. In response, the Spanish federation stated they had not been notified by Barcelona about any injury concerns regarding Yamal. On a brighter note for Barcelona, midfielder Frenkie de Jong will be available. He was sidelined for the Valencia match after an injury with the Netherlands national team during the international break. Last season, Barcelona advanced to the semifinals of the Champions League, where they were knocked out by Inter Milan. AP SSC SSC
